During this activity, students get the chance to create and read words like “birdhouse” or “carpet.” These words contain R-controlled vowels, which can be tricky for many young learners. R-controlled vowels occur when a vowel is followed by the letter “r,” affecting its pronunciation. For example, the “o” in “word” sounds different than it would in “stone.” By engaging with multisyllabic words, students can develop their decoding skills and expand their vocabulary.
